RSM is at the forefront of conducting and facilitating research that is deeply rooted in the cultural and social realities of Ayiti. By integrating indigenous knowledge with contemporary mental health practices, RSM produces research that not only fills critical gaps in global mental health understanding but also directly informs the development of effective, culturally-sensitive mental health interventions for Haitian communities both on the island and in the diaspora.

Rebati Santé Mentale offers expert consultation to support organizations in conducting meaningful, culturally grounded research and evaluation. Our services ensure that mental health tools, interventions, and findings truly reflect the experiences and needs of Haitian communities.

We specialize in:

Tool Adaptation – Guiding the cultural and linguistic adaptation of mental health assessments and interventions to ensure they are accurate, relevant, and respectful.

Research Design – Assisting with qualitative and mixed-methods research that captures culturally specific insights and community narratives

Program Evaluation – Designing and implementing evaluation strategies that assess impact, highlight successes, and inform improvements using culturally responsive frameworks.
